Bulandshahr: A girl was severely injured when her brother threw acid on her for being in love with a boy from another religion, police said on Tuesday in Bulandshahr.
The incident occurred early this morning in Charora village where the victim, Gulshan, was found lying unconscious on the bank of Ganga canal on the outskirts of the town, they said.
According to Chief Medical Superintendent Dr S P Ahuja, the victim was brought to the District Hospital by a home guard constable and admitted with 55 per cent burns.
A case has been registered based on the victim's statement and her father Asgar has been arrested, they said, adding her brother is still absconding.
